Why Does Proper Heat Pump Installation Matter?

A heat pump performs best when the system matches the space it serves. Unit size, airflow design, and electrical setup all affect daily performance. We study these details before installation so the system can deliver balanced heating and cooling across the home.

Energy use also depends on correct installation. A poorly sized or misplaced unit may run longer cycles and waste power. With the right setup, the system operates more efficiently. What’s the Typical Heat Pump Setup Price in Conroe, TX?

System Size and Capacity

The size of the heat pump affects the overall project cost. Larger homes often require stronger systems with higher-capacity ratings. Equipment with greater output often costs more. This factor plays a role when homeowners review the cost of installing a heat pump in Conroe before planning a new system.

Equipment Model and Energy Rating

Heat pumps come in several efficiency levels. High-efficiency models can reduce long-term energy use. These systems may have a higher purchase price, but they often provide steady comfort and lower energy demand. This factor can affect the price of the heat pump setup in Conroe.

Installation Complexity and Labor

Some homes require extra work during installation. Duct adjustments, electrical upgrades, or structural changes may affect labor time. Properties with older systems may need more preparation before the new equipment can operate properly.

Property Layout and Installation Conditions

The structure of the home can influence installation work. Tight attic spaces, long duct runs, or outdoor placement needs may increase project time. These conditions often play a role in the final cost of the residential heat pump installation.

Replacement vs New Installation

Projects that replace old equipment may involve extra removal work. A full system upgrade may also require changes to ductwork or electrical lines. These factors affect the total heat pump replacement and installation cost for many homeowners.

Many homeowners notice signs before replacement becomes necessary. Frequent repairs, uneven indoor temperatures, and rising energy bills may point to an aging system. Older units may also struggle to reach the thermostat setting. When these issues appear often, a new installation can offer better comfort and improved system performance.

Heat pumps work well in areas with moderate winter temperatures, such as Conroe, TX. The system provides both heating and cooling from one unit. Many homeowners choose it to replace older HVAC equipment. When installed correctly, a heat pump can support balanced indoor comfort while reducing energy use compared with older heating systems.

The correct system size depends on several factors. These include the home’s square footage, insulation levels, window placement, and airflow design.
